## Tuning

The Dovebank garage occupancy feed polls gate sensors and publishes a smoothed count to the Wayfield dashboard. Most incidents trace back to tuning, not code: too-short smoothing windows cause flapping counts, and too-long poll intervals make the feed look stale. Adjust one constant at a time and watch the dashboard for a full cycle before touching another. The defaults are listed below.

constants for fajop-tahaf:
RATE_LIMITS = {
    "holael": 2,
    "oliael": 10,
    "druael": 10,
    "wenwyn": 10,
}

Subject: Cron migration to Fennelworks complete

Team,

As of this morning, all nightly cron jobs on the Oristead cluster have been migrated to the Fennelworks workflow engine. Scheduling, retries, and alerting are now handled in one place, and the old crontab entries have been disabled but not deleted until next sprint. Dagmar will monitor the first two runs. If anything misfires, escalate in the release channel. The migration run can be verified against the token below.

session token of tajef-bageg = htk21_5d90d574934f3ccae6437

Hello plugin authors,

Next Thursday, Corbexa will run a disaster-recovery drill for the RestockRoute vending-machine restock planner. During the failover window, plugin callbacks will be replayed against the standby scheduler, so please ensure your handlers are idempotent and tolerate duplicate route assignments. No customer restock data will be altered. To re-register your plugin against the standby environment during the drill, authenticate with the recovery passphrase provided below.

vault phrase of hahip-tajeg = quenax-briath-briax

# Break-Glass: Catalog Cache Invalidation

Scope: the Pinrow product catalog at Veldstone Retail. If stale prices persist after a purge and the Hollowmere invalidation queue is wedged, use break-glass to flush the edge tier directly. Contractors: get verbal sign-off from the catalog lead first. Steps: open the Hollowmere admin shell, select emergency-flush, confirm the tenant, and run it once — repeated flushes thrash the origin. Access is logged and expires after 20 minutes. Unseal the admin shell with the passphrase below.

recovery phrase for kahop-tajog: istix-casvan